Red tide, an impermanent natural phenomenon including harmful algal blooms, causes changing the color of the sea generally to red or almost brown, and has a serious impact. Red tide in florida and texas is caused by the rapid growth of a microscopic algae called karenia brevis. When large amounts of this algae are present, it can cause a harmful algal bloom (hab) that. This massive growth of algae can become harmful to both the environment and humans, which is why scientists often refer to them as harmful algal blooms or habs. This bloom, like many habs, is caused by microscopic algae that produce toxins that kill fish and make shellfish dangerous to eat. When nutrients from inland areas. There is no single cause of red tides or other harmful algae blooms, though abundant nourishment must be present in seawater to support the explosive growth of dinoflagellates. Harmful algal blooms (habs) can occur in fresh, marine (salt), and brackish (a mixture of fresh and salt) water bodies around the world.
